1 using System;
2 using System.Collections.Generic;
3 using System.Linq;
4 using System.Text;
5 using System.Threading.Tasks;
6
7 namespace _02day变量
8 {
9 class Program
10 {
11 /// <summary>
12 /// 变量的学习
13 /// </summary>
14 /// <param name="args"></param>
15 static void Main(string[] args)
16 {
17 int number; long lnumber = 999999999999; //整数 long 长度更长
18 number = 22;
19 short snumber = 3;//短数值;
20 double pi; pi = 3.1415976584; float piu=32.5F;//小数 float后面加F
21 char aa = 'A';//字符 一个字符
22 string wname = "小王", lsname = "小吴"; //长字符串类型
23 string uage = number.ToString(); //把整型转成字符串
24 decimal money = 38888555.123665m; //货币数值 后同加上M或m
25 bool yesno = true;//布尔类型
26 Console.WriteLine(number+lnumber+snumber);
27 Console.WriteLine(piu+pi);
28 Console.WriteLine(aa + wname+lsname+money+yesno);
29 Console.ReadKey();
30 //变量的命名规则
31 // 【1】必须以“字母”、或 @ 符号开头,不要以数字开头
32 //【2】后面可以跟任意“字母”、“数字”、“下划线”
33 //注意
34 //你起得变量名 不要与 C# 系统中的关键字重复
35 //在C#中,大小写是敏感的
36 //同一个变量名不允许重复定义(先这么认为,不严谨)
37 //【3】定义变量时,变量名要有意义
38 //【4】C#变量命名编码规范——Camel 命名法:
39 //首个单词的首字母小写,其余单次的首字母大写
40 //【5】Pascal 命名规范:每一个单词第一个字母都要大写(详细见下表)
41 //【6】如果使用到英文单词的缩写,全部用大写
42 //命名方法 规则 用途 例子
43 //Pascal 大小写 标识符中每个单词都首字母大写 用于类型名和成员名 CarDeck ,DealersHead
44 //Camel 大小写 除第一个单词以外,标识符中所有的单词都首字母大写 用于本地变量和方法参数 strName ,strChineseName
45
46
47
48 }
49 }
50 }